I tried this in jsFiddle, and it works well in Chrome & FF, need to check on other browsers as well.
Convert the byte[]
to Base64
using,
string base64PDF = System.Convert.ToBase64String(outputPDF, 0, outputPDF.Length);
All I had to do is specify the MIME type
as data:application/pdf;base64,
in the source and give the Base64
version of the PDF
.
<object data="data:application/pdf;base64, JVBERi0xLjQKJeLjz9MKMyA..." type="application/pdf" width="160px">
<embed src="data:application/pdf;base64, JVBERi0xLjQKJeLjz9MKMyA..." type="application/pdf" />
</object>
I couldn't be able to hide the top toolbar which appears in FF by appending #toolbar=0&navpanes=0&statusbar=0
.
IE8 needs a saved pdf file to be displayed.
